Guatemala: Fear for Safety: Relatives and witnesses in the trial of Juan Chanay Pablo

Twelve former members of a civil defence patrol imprisoned for the 1993 extrajudicial execution of villager Juan Chanay Pablo were freed from jail after the jail was attacked by a large group of their supporters. The escaped men are said to have fled to Mexico. Amnesty International is concerned that relatives of Juan Chanay Pablo and witnesses to his murder may now be at risk
